.Zach Anderson.Aug 30, 2024 23:55.opBNB increases its throughput ability to 10,000 TPS by raising the block gasoline limitation to 200M/s, transforming deal rate and also effectiveness. opBNB, a Coating 2 scaling service on the BNB Establishment, has effectively multiplied its own throughput ability to 10,000 deals per 2nd (TPS) through improving the block gasoline restriction coming from 100M/s to 200M/s, depending on to the BNB Establishment Blog.Performance MilestoneThe considerable efficiency turning point was achieved with a collection of marketing aimed at enriching the efficiency and also rate of purchase handling. These marketing feature renovations in the network performance computing price, implementation approaches, as well as block development processes.Testing Atmosphere and also DeploymentDuring the pressure testing period, the opBNB group noted that direct relationships demanded added computing information, which could influence deal performance.
To resolve this, they selected a peer-to-peer (p2p) link through a stand-in node, lessening information waste and making certain the bottleneck was actually out the network connection.In the examination setting, the staff simulated real mainnet information along with 12,500 k accounts, including 10k energetic profiles, to attain a practical evaluation of opBNB’s capabilities.Block Creation ProcessopBNB utilizes the OP Stack as well as consists of 2 clients: RollupDriver (op-node) and also EngineAPI (op-geth). The RollupDriver manages the whole entire exploration process, setting off the EngineAPI to consist of Layer 2 (L2) transactions in to a block. The block development method involves a number of measures, from triggering the process to wrapping up the block, guaranteeing reliable and also dependable deal processing.Optimization TechniquesScheduling OptimizationThe preliminary layout had a 600ms hard restriction for block manufacturing as well as completing processes.
To optimize efficiency, opBNB removed this difficult limit, permitting additional time for block production and also purchase incorporation. This adjustment considerably lowered the moment needed for kickoff and block creation, enriching overall efficiency.Kickoff OptimizationBy offering a specialized process to pre-fetch the Layer 1 (L1) state and also wait in a cache, opBNB minimized the L1 state retrieval opportunity coming from over 200ms to lower than 10ms. This asynchronous mode of retrieving the L1 state got rid of the necessity for sequencers to expect L1 endpoints, thus enhancing performance.Block Manufacturing OptimizationTransaction implementation in the course of block production was maximized through caching and concurrency.
The cached purchase implementation leads can be reused, decreasing the steps demanded for block verification as well as commitment. In addition, block devotion processes were actually split into simultaneous steps, additionally improving throughput.Hardware as well as Examination ResultsThe screening was performed using AWS m6in 12X big with an IO2 hard drive (6000 IOPS, 1500MB/s throughput). The opBNB technology stack featured op-geth 0.4.3 and op-node 0.4.3.
Following the marketing, the TPS for transmission purchases varied in between 10,500 as well as 11,500, showing a substantial improvement in performance.ConclusionThrough continual renovation as well as advancement, opBNB has efficiently increased its own throughput capacity to 10,000 TPS by boosting the block gas restriction to 200M/s. These enhancements make opBNB a high-performance atmosphere suited for requiring applications including exchanging dApps as well as blockchain games.Image source: Shutterstock.